Young professionals can now be part of the Delhi government’s fellowship programme, wherein they will get a chance to work with the Government. The Chief Minister’s Urban Leaders Fellowship (CMULF) offers a great opportunity for young leaders across the country to work with the Government to resolve some of the important issues being faced today in urban India.
Those under 35, with a passion for public service and keen to work with the Delhi government for at least two years, can apply. The fellows will work under respective ministers and departments.
They will be required to help formulate policies and implement various projects and programmes. There are 17 positions open for fellows and six for associate fellows. A salary of Rs 1.25 lakh will be paid to them per month. Associate fellows will be paid Rs 75,000 a month.
Those interested may apply before August 9, for the batch that starts work in October. More details are available on ddc.delhi.gov.in/cmulf website.
For the position of fellow, the candidates will have to possess a PhD with one year full-time work experience or a postgraduate degree with minimum of 60 per cent marks along with at least three years of full-time work experience. Those with MBBS and LLB may also apply.
The initiative is being implemented under the aegis of the Administrative Reforms Department and Government of NCT of Delhi in partnership with the Dialogue and Development Commission (DDC) and various line departments of the Government of NCT of Delhi.
